Sen-Ryo – The New Affordably-Luxurious Japanese Restaurant @ ION

Opened for the first-time in Singapore on 1st April 2021, Sen-Ryo is an established Japanese restaurant which dates as far back as 1999. Well-known for exceptional authentic Japanese cuisine that is masterfully crafted by a team of shokunin, Sen-Ryo utilizes only quality ingredients imported from Toyosu Fish Market and around the world. Armed with expertise in seafood; in particular, tuna, and an outstanding repertoire of sushi and authentic Japanese dishes, Sen-Ryo is set to impress diners in Singapore with premium but pocket-friendly creations that promise affordable-luxury at its best.

Situated in the heart of town, at ION Orchard, Sen-Ryo serves up a multitude of culturally-inspired dishes comprising of sustainably-grown Koshihikari rice from the Aomori prefecture, fresh seafood imported twice weekly from the renowned Toyosu Fish Market, fragrant artisanal vinegar traditionally fermented in the Gifu prefecture, and shoyu from Igagoe, brewed for an extensive period of one year for enhanced flavour.

The Bar

Greeting guests with an impressive liquor bar, decked in a myriad of exquisite sake and shochu from Japan, Sen-Ryo features strips of warm lighting, and thin columns of wood which serve as a divider between the bar and sushi counter.

Offering a selection of Japanese fruit wine, including the fragrant Kodakara Yamagata La France ($11 for 100ml and $75 for 720ml), and citrusy Bijoufu Yuzu Shuwa ($9 for 100ml, and $40 for 500ml), the restaurant also serves an exquisite collection of sake in the form of the $238 Ohime 2 Grain Hiire Yamadanishiki from the Yamaguchi prefecture, $105 Hyakujuro Jumai Daiginjyo Black Face from the Gifu prefecture.

The Grill

Complete with a lively sushi and grill counter, Sen-Ryo invites guests to witness the restaurant’s skilled team of artisan chefs at work, as they craft an enticing menu of fresh sashimi, sushi and grilled dishes.

Of their innumerable selection, the most notable include, the $58 DIY Hokkaido Uni, $7.80 Grilled Chicken Thigh in Charcoal Style Sauce, and $28 Grilled US Beef Tenderloin and Foie Gras.

Private Dining

Other than the sake bar and the sushi and grill counter, diners can also choose to be seated in Sen-Ryo’s two intimate dining rooms, which showcase cosy booth seats and dark wood furniture, accentuated by grey textured walls.

Seating a mere eight and five guests respectively, or up to 14 guests when combined, Sen-Ryo imposes a minimum spend of $400 for lunch and $800 for dinner when booking either one of the private dining rooms.
